Isaiah Likely injury: Ravens TE carted to locker room at practice

Mere hours after rumors began to swirl online that the Baltimore Ravens had extended rising star tight end Isaiah Likely, Likely was carted back to the locker room near the end of practice on Tuesday.
Likely was hurt during a one on one rep with Ravens safety Sanoussi Kane, per Jeff Zrebiec of The Athletic–Baltimore. Following practice, Ravens head coach John Harbaugh told reporters that Likely had rolled his ankle and is expected to miss a few weeks.
The Coastal Carolina alum is heading into his fourth NFL season after being selected by the Ravens with the No. 139 pick in the Fourth Round of the 2022 NFL Draft. He has evolved into a big-time pass catcher for 2x NFL MVP Lamar Jackson, as his yardage and touchdown production has increased every season of his career.
“I want to see [Likely] be an All-Pro,” Harbaugh said back in May. “That’d be my goal for him, and he’s capable of it.”
Likely heading into his final year on rookie contract
Through three campaigns, Likely boasts 108 career receptions for 1,261 receiving yards and 14 touchdowns. He poured in the performance of his career in Baltimore’s season-opening loss to the Kansas City Chiefs last season, as he hauled in 111 yards and one touchdown. He would have scored the game-winning touchdown with no time remaining, but his foot landed barely out of bounds.

“I tell everybody I love the Ravens, I love the city,” Likely said following the 2024 season. “You all brought me in and made me feel like I’m part of a family from my rookie year until now. Everybody’s dream is to get extended but I just keep one foot in front of the other. I try to stay in the moment, stay where my feet are and really just play and have fun and let the plays happen. And then whatever happens, I let God take care of that.”
If the rumors are true about Likely receiving an extension, it would likely land somewhere in the ballpark of Dallas Cowboys tight end Jake Ferguson‘s recent four-year, $52 million extension. The Coastal Carolina alum will head into the upcoming season on the final season of his rookie contract, making $3,406,000. In his first three seasons, Likely made a combined $3,640,246.
Baltimore opens play in the preseason on Aug. 7 against the Indianapolis Colts, although it is now unlikely that Likely will suit up for that one. The Ravens’ regular season opener is scheduled for Sept. 7 against the Buffalo Bills.
